Paula Barber, our Director of Administration, joined Temple Beth-El in 2006. She works closely with our clergy, office staff members and lay leaders overseeing membership and member relations, financial management, program coordination, facility management, and communications.
Before joining the staff at Temple Beth-El, Paula was Community Relations Director and Medical Social Worker for Patient Care, Inc. in Essex County, NJ. A licensed clinical social worker, Paula is also a graduate of the Chubb Institute, with a diploma in Network Engineering and Data Communications. Paula was Director of Administration for Homeless Solutions, Inc. in Morris County, NJ. She currently serves on the Ritual Committee of the Morristown Jewish Center where she is a member, and is a regular volunteer at the Community Soup Kitchen at the Church of the Redeemer in Morristown. Paula has served on the boards of many non-profit organizations within New Jersey, providing her skills and knowledge on the strategic planning committees of both the Guardianship Association of New Jersey and First Call for Help, and serving as treasurer for both the NJ Professional Geriatric Care Managers and Aviva Hadassah.
Paula Barber lives in Morristown, NJ with her husband Howard. They have three children, Jacob, Joseph and Shoshannah.
